Perovskite nanoparticles possess exceptional optical, electronic, and chemical properties, which include high absorption coefficients, tunable bandgaps, and long charge-carrier diffusion lengths. These features make them ideal for applications in solar cells, light-emitting diodes (LEDs), photodetectors, and other optoelectronic devices.